The essentials
This fitness tracker smartwatch is designed to pair with your phone and show notifications, plus it lets you interact with calls. The Bluetooth call and message support means you can answer or reject incoming calls from the watch, and you’ll get vibration and ring alerts for call and message notifications.
On the health side, it supports heart rate, blood oxygen, stress, and sleep monitoring. For day-to-day movement, it includes step counting and an activity tracker intended to log daily activity like steps, calories, speed, distance, and active time.

There’s also an Alexa built-in feature set, aimed at making the watch feel more like a command point for simple tasks—music, news, weather checks, and smart home control are specifically mentioned.

Key points to consider before buying
It’s important to be realistic about positioning. With the features listed—100+ sport modes, health monitoring, Alexa built-in, and call handling—it offers a lot for the category, but it may sit closer to mid-range “feature packed” rather than something you’d choose if you’re chasing the most advanced smartwatch experience.
Also, the water resistance is specific: it’s IP68 waterproof to a depth of 100 meters for 3–5 minutes. That’s suitable for swimming and everyday wet situations like washing hands or rainy weather, but it’s explicitly not suitable for diving, scuba diving, hot water bathing, or high-speed water sports. If your use involves heavier water activities, you may want to skip this and choose something that’s designed for that.
Finally, it does mention compatibility—iOS 9.0 and above, and Android 6.0 and above—so if you’re on something older or unusual, you’ll need to double-check.
Tech specs

- Display: 1.8-inch screen, full touch screen
- Screen protection: 2.5D glass
- Water resistance: IP68 waterproof, depth up to 100 meters for 3–5 minutes
- Health monitoring: heart rate, blood oxygen, stress and sleep monitor
- Activity tracking: step counter and all-day activity tracking (steps, calories, speed, distance, active time)
- Sports modes: 100+ sport modes
- Connectivity/features: Bluetooth call and message, call notifications, SMS and APP messages
- Alexa built-in: music, news, weather, smart home control (as listed)
- Screen time modes: 3 bright modes
- Battery notes: approx. 2.5 hours full charging time, normal service life approx. 10 days, more than 30 days standby, and more than 35 days standby mentioned
- Compatibility: iOS 9.0+ and Android 6.0+
- Other functions: music control, reminders, alarm, stopwatch timer, menstrual cycle
